Output 38a69f9ddf4a1345c94fcf9d92815dac8774ed97ce26b9145a371995c79efc95:1

value
3560504
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4df917a3b2779402927dd8e88dfa0211a7a5f536 OP_EQUAL
address
38oJMZ5vd3Ahi5yTCQDwWWQDS8MeKQAjEy
transaction
38a69f9ddf4a1345c94fcf9d92815dac8774ed97ce26b9145a371995c79efc95
confirmations
201082
spent
true